Role-based access in the Quartzleaf wiki is evaluated by the internal Gatewright service, which maps each reader, editor, and steward role to page-level permissions. When support needs to diagnose why a user cannot view or edit a page, query Gatewright's role-lookup endpoint directly rather than inspecting the wiki database. All lookup requests must include the support team's service key in the authorization header. That key is:

API key for yahig-tadup: kto7_ubizbYm

Changed defaults in Splitfork, our assignment service. Bucketing now uses sticky hashing per account instead of per session, and the holdout slice grew from 2% to 5%. Callers relying on session-level reassignment must opt in explicitly. Review the diff against the new baseline; the updated default configuration is listed below.

config for tagep-kajof:
[casir]
port = 6379
region = south-1
host = casir.paliqdyn.example
team = tamax
timeout_ms = 250
retries = 2

- [ ] Before the Quillhaven signing ceremony proceeds, run the leaked-file-descriptor hunt on the offline signer. As a new contractor, please be thorough: enumerate every open descriptor on the sealed host, confirm nothing points at the ceremony scratch volume, and log each finding in the Larkspur register. If any descriptor traces back to the retired Fenwick exporter, halt and page the ceremony lead. Once the host shows a clean descriptor table, unlock the escrow envelope using the phrase below.

unlock words, yajof-tagef: aldiel-kasath-briax-fraeth-pelius-olieth-pelix-wenius-wenael-norael

Handover: circuit breaker for the Brightmoor pricing API.

Breaker lives in the Kestrel client wrapper — opens after five consecutive failures, half-opens after 30s. Reviewers should check that fallback responses stay cache-only and that breaker state is emitted to metrics. Config changes need a second pair of eyes from the owner named below.

named custodian: Belius Casath Ulaix Sorius